Dermatomyositis (DM) is a chronic multi-systemic inflammatory disorder of autoimmune origin, which has been associated with cardiovascular complications, including ventricular arrhythmias and sudden cardiac death. The Tp-e interval and Tp-e/QT ratio have been accepted as new markers for the assessment of myocardial repolarization and ventricular arrhythmogenesis. The aim of this study was to evaluate ventricular repolarization by using Tp-e interval and Tp-e/QT ratio in patients with DM, and to assess the relation with inflammation and autoimmunity. This study included 281 DM patients (180 females, 101 males; mean age 52.73 ± 15.80 years) and 281 control subjects (180 females, 101 males; mean age 53.38 ± 15.72 years). QTc, Tp-e interval and Tp-e/QT ratio were measured from the 12-lead ECG. The plasma level of blood routine test, C-reactive protein (CRP), erythrocyte sedimentation rate (ESR) was measured. These parameters were compared between groups. No statistically significant difference was found between two groups in terms of basic characteristics. In electrocardiographic parameters analysis, QTc, Tp-e interval and Tp-e/QT ratio were significantly increased in DM patients compared to the control group (441.44 ± 26.62 ms vs 422.72 ± 11.7 ms, 104.16 ± 24.34 ms vs 77.23 ± 16.25 ms and 0.27 ± 0.06 ms vs 0.20 ± 0.04 ms, all P value < 0.01). QTc, Tp-e interval and Tp-e/QT were positively correlated with NLR, CRP, and ESR (all P values < 0.01), and were increased in anti-Ro/SSA-52kD positive patients compared to those negative (452.33 ± 24.89 ms vs 438.55 ± 26.37 ms, 114.05 ± 22.68 ms vs 101.53 ± 24.13 ms, and 0.29 ± 0.06 ms vs 0.27 ± 0.05 ms, all P value < 0.01). Our study demonstrated that QTc, Tp-e interval, and Tp-e/QT ratio were increased in DM patients and were associated with inflammatory markers and anti-Ro/SSA-52kD positivity.

BACKGROUND: Currently, there is a lack of research on the Tp-Te interval and Tp-e/QT ratio in obese adolescents who have metabolic syndrome. AIM: Our study aims to compare established ventricular repolarization parameters with these intervals and ratios in obese adolescents with or without metabolic syndrome, alongside a healthy control group, while exploring the association of these repolarization parameters with cardiovascular risk factors and echocardiographic variables. METHODS: The study included 100 obese adolescents and 50 lean subjects, with the obese participants categorized into two subgroups. The Tp-Te interval was identified as the duration from the peak to the end of the T wave. RESULTS: The metabolic and non-metabolic syndrome obese groups exhibited significantly elevated QTc and TpTe values compared to the control group, with no statistically significant differences observed in minimum QT, maximum QT, QT dispersion, QTc dispersion, TpTe dispersion, and TpTe/QT ratio values among obese subjects with metabolic or non-metabolic syndrome and controls. Specifically, TpTe values were significantly elevated in the non-metabolic syndrome obese groups compared to controls, while minimum TpTe values were significantly elevated in the metabolic syndrome obese groups compared to controls, and the prolongation of the QTc interval was notably elevated in the obese groups than in controls. CONCLUSIONS: Obese adolescents demonstrated an elevated TpTe interval compared to healthy controls, without any significant differences observed in TpTe dispersion, and TpTe/QT ratio values between the two groups. Results of our study showed that a negative correlation between TpTe and HDL-cholesterol and a positive correlation between the TpTe/QT ratio and insulin sensitivity indices in adolescents with metabolic syndrome.

BACKGROUND: Obstructive sleep apnea (OSA) is significantly associated with a higher risk of ventricular arrhythmia (VA). QT, the Tp-e/QT ratio, and QT dispersion (QTd) are used to evaluate myocardial repolarization and are highly correlated with VA. The aim was to evaluate the predictive value of the Tp-e/QT ratio and other electrocardiogram (ECG) parameters for nocturnal premature ventricular contractions (PVCs) in patients with OSA. METHODS: We retrospectively analyzed data from patients with OSA and conducted a 1:1 matched cohort study. Patients diagnosed with OSA who met our criteria for the PVC group, and sex- and age-matched patients with OSA who met our criteria for the control group were enrolled in the study. The Tp-e, Tp-e/QT ratio, corrected QT interval (QTc), corrected Tp-e interval (Tp-ec), and QTd were measured, calculated and analyzed. RESULTS: Patients in the PVC group (n = 31) showed a greater Tp-e, Tp-ec, QTc, Tp-e/QT ratio, and QTd than patients in the control group (n = 31). In the univariate binary logistic regression analysis, higher Tp-ec (OR: 1.025; P = 0.042), QTc (OR: 1.014; P = 0.036), Tp-e/QT ratio (OR: 1.675; P < 0.001), and QTd (OR: 1.052; P = 0.012) values were all significantly associated with nocturnal PVCs. In multivariate analysis and receiver operating characteristic analysis, a higher Tp-e/QT ratio (OR: 2.168; 95% CI: 0.762-0.952; P < 0.001) was an independent predictor of nocturnal PVCs. CONCLUSIONS: The QTc, Tp-e/QT ratio, and QTd in patients with OSA with nocturnal PVCs were significantly increased compared with those in patients without nocturnal PVCs. A prolonged Tp-e/QT ratio was an independent predictor of nocturnal PVCs in patients with OSA.

AIM: The cardio-ankle vascular index (CAVI) is a marker of arterial stiffness, and elevated CAVI values have been reported to be associated with an increased risk of cardiovascular mortality and cardiac arrhythmia. This study aimed to evaluate the relationship between Tp-e interval and CAVI, which is associated with cardiac arrhythmia on electrocardiography (ECG). METHOD: The study included patients with hypertension whose blood pressure values were taken under control with optimal medical treatment. Arterial stiffness and CAVI were measured using the vascular scanning system VaSera VS-1000. The patients were divided into two groups as CAVI<9 and CAVI≥9. Ventricular repolarization markers QT and QTc intervals, Tp-e interval, and Tp-e/QT and Tp-e/QTc ratios were measured using 12­lead ECG. RESULTS: Tp-e interval (78.7 ± 10.3 vs. 63.6 ± 9.1, p < 0.001), Tp-e/QT ratio (0.018 ± 0.02 vs. 0.015 ± 0.02, p < 0.001), and Tp-e/QTc ratio (0.17 ± 0.02 vs. 0.14 ± 0.04, p = 0.025) were statistically significantly higher in the CAVI≥9 group compared to the CAVI<9 group. In the prediction of patients in the CAVI≥9 group, Tp-e interval had an area under the curve value of 0.862 (0.784-0.940, p < 0.001) at the cut-off point of >72.5 msec, indicating a statistically significant result. Left CAVI and right CAVI were found to be significantly correlated with Tp-e interval (r = -0.650, p < 0.001 and r = -0.663, p < 0.001, respectively). CONCLUSION: We found that elevated CAVI values were associated and positively correlated with prolonged Tp-e interval values in patients with hypertension. Patients with elevated CAVI values should be followed up closely to prevent cardiac arrhythmic events.

Background and Objectives: Smokeless tobacco (ST) use has recently become an alternative to cigarettes, and it has been concluded that ST is at least as harmful as cigarettes. ST use is thought to play a role in the pathogenesis of arrhythmia by affecting ventricular repolarization. In this study, we aimed to examine the relationships of Maras powder (MP), one of the ST varieties, with epicardial fat thickness and new ventricular repolarization parameters, which have not previously been described. Materials and Methods: A total of 289 male individuals were included in this study between April 2022 and December 2022. Three groups, 97 MP users, 97 smokers, and 95 healthy (non-tobacco), were compared according to electrocardiographic and echocardiographic data. Electrocardiograms (ECG) were evaluated with a magnifying glass by two expert cardiologists at a speed of 50 m/s. Epicardial fat thickness (EFT) was measured by echocardiography in the parasternal short- and long-axis images. A model was created with variables that could affect epicardial fat thickness. Results: There were no differences between the groups regarding body mass index (p = 0.672) and age (p = 0.306). The low-density lipoprotein value was higher in the MP user group (p = 0.003). The QT interval was similar between groups. Tp-e (p = 0.022), cTp-e (p = 0.013), Tp-e/QT (p =0.005), and Tp-e/cQT (p = 0.012) were higher in the MP user group. While the Tp-e/QT ratio did not affect EFT, MP predicted the epicardial fat thickness (p < 0.001, B = 0.522, 95%CI 0.272-0.773). Conclusions: Maras powder may play a role in ventricular arrhythmia by affecting EFT and causing an increase in the Tp-e interval.

BACKGROUND: Cardiovascular complications, including ventricular arrhythmias associated with abnormalities of ventricular repolarization, are the leading cause of morbidity and mortality in patients with acromegaly. Herein, we aimed to investigate ventricular repolarization using Tp-e interval, Tp-e interval/QT, and Tp-e interval/QTc ratios in acromegalic patients compared to healthy subjects. METHODS: A total of 29 patients (aged 51.9 ± 11.2, 65.5% women) with acromegaly and 30 control subjects (aged 47.3 ± 14.4, 63.3% women) were enrolled in the study. Tp-e and QT interval, corrected QT (QTc), Tp-e/QT, and Tp-e/QTc ratios were calculated from the 12-lead electrocardiogram. RESULTS: Tp-e interval (89.28 ± 12.16 vs. 75.97 ± 9.92 ms; p < 0.001), Tp-e/QT ratio (0.237 ± 0.045 vs. 0.212 ± 0.029; p = 0.019), and Tp-e/ QTc ratio (0.218 ± 0.031 vs. 0.195 ± 0.026; p = 0.003) were significantly higher in patients with acromegaly compared to control group. A positive correlation was determined between left atrial volume index (LAVI) and Tp-e interval (r = 0.272, p = 0.039). DISCUSSION: The current study is the first to have shown significantly increased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io were increased in acromegalic patients. These results may be important for screening malignant arrhythmic events in acromegaly.

BACKGROUND: Primary hyperparathyroidism (PHPT) is an endocrine disorder characterized by hypercalcemia caused by excessive parathyroid hormone (PTH) secretion from the parathyroid gland. PHPT was previously shown to increase cardiac arrhythmias. Besides, new indices, such as the Tpeak-Tend (Tp-e) interval, Tp-e interval/QT interval (Tp-e/QT) ratio, and Tp-e interval/corrected QT interval (Tp-e/QTc) ratio may be associated with ventricular arrhythmias and sudden cardiac death. Therefore, we aimed to investigate the relationship between PHPT and the changes to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io. METHODS: We carried out the study with 41 patients with PHPT and 40 control subjects. We calculated the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io of the participants from the V5 derivations on their ECG papers. While we defined Tp-e interval as the distance between the peak and the end of the T wave, Tp-e/QT and Tp-e/QTc ratios were calculated by dividing Tp-e by QT and Tp-e by QTc, respectively. RESULTS: Total calcium, albumin-corrected calcium, phosphorus, and PTH levels were significantly higher in patients with PHPT. We also found positive correlations between albumin-corrected calcium and PTH levels and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io (p < 0.001). DISCUSSION: : Our results suggest that Tp-e may enhance the current knowledge on arrhythmic risk in PHPT patients better than basal ECG. In addition, both high PTH and high calcium levels appear to have the potential to cause arrhythmogenic effects.

PURPOSE: Noise, defined as any sound that is unpleasant, is one of the most important environmental problems. Prolonged exposure to noise has been shown to be associated with the development of cardiovascular diseases. No study investigated the effect of noise on surface electrocardiography (ECG). AIMS: The aim of our study is to investigate the effect of noise on surface ECG parameters including P-wave dispersion (PWD), QT intervals, corrected QT interval (QTc), T-wave peak to end (Tp-e) interval, and Tp-e/QT and Tp-e/QTc ratios. METHODS: A total of 51 people working in the textile factory affected by the noise and 43 volunteers without any disease and who were not exposed to noise were included in this study. The average noise level in the textile factory was 112 dB. A 12-lead ECG was obtained from all individuals. PR interval, PWD, QRS duration, QT interval, QTc interval, Tp-e interval, and Tp-e/QT and Tp-e/QTc ratios were calculated for all individuals. RESULTS: The noise group had significantly increased PWD [35 (28-40) vs. 28 (22-36) p = 0.029], QT interval ( 373.5 ± 27.3 vs. 359.3 ± 2.74, p = 0.001), QTc interval [(409 ± 21 vs. 403 ± 13 p = 0.045)], Tp-e interval [(90.6 ± 6.0 vs. 83.5 ± 7.3 p < 0.001)], Tp-e/QT [(0.24 ± 0.03 vs. 0.23 ± 0.02, p = 0.015)] and Tp-e/QTc [(0.22 ± 0.02 vs. 0.21 ± 0.02 p < 0.001)] compared to control group. Also, duration of working was positively correlated with PWD (r = 0.468, p = 0.001) and Tp-e/QTc ratio (r = 0.328, p = 0.019). In multiple linear regression linear regression analysis, noise was the independent predictor of both PWD (ß = 0.244, p = 0.032) and Tp-e/QTc (ß = 0.319, p = 0.003) CONCLUSION: We showed that noise significantly increased PWD, QT and Tp-e interval measurements. Also, noise was the independent predictor for both PWD and Tp-e/QTc.

Background: Tp-e interval, Tp-e/QT ratio and Tp-e/QTc ratio are electrocardiographic markers and indices of ventricular arrhythmogenic events. We aimed to investigate ventricular repolarization in normal weight, overweight, obese and morbidly obese individuals by using ECG parameters including the above markers.Methods: A total of 310 obese patients with various cardiac complaints, who were admitted to our outpatient clinic between May 2020 and January 2021, were prospectively included in the study. Using the World Health Organization (WHO) body mass index (BMI) classification, patients were divided into four groups: normal weight (18.5-24.9 kg/m2, n = 48), overweight (25-29.9 kg/m2, n = 98), obese (30-39.9 kg/m2, n = 119), and morbidly obese (>40 kg/m2, n = 45).Results: The morbidly obese and normal groups were younger in age than the other two groups. The Tp-e interval values for Groups I-IV were 72.1 ± 6.9, 73.1 ± 6.2, 75.7 ± 7.3 and 81.1 ± 6.9, respectively, and significantly different (P < .001). We found that age, BMI, systolic blood pressure (BP) and diastolic BP were independent predictors of a prolonged Tp-e interval.Conclusions: The principal finding of our study was the gradual increase in Tp-e interval, Tp-e/QT ratio and Tp-e/QTc ratio starting from the overweight stage and these parameters gradually increase in obese and morbidly obese patients. Additionally, systolic and diastolic blood pressure predicted Tp-e interval, Tp-e/QT ratio and Tp-e/QTc ratio.

BACKGROUND: Low iron storage is a common health problem around the world. Although the association of low iron storage with cardiovascular events and various electrocardiographic parameters has been investigated, its association with fragmented QRS (fQRS), Tpeak-Tend (Tp-e) interval, Tp-e/QT and Tp-e/QTc ratios, which are important criteria for repolarization, has not been studied in adults. METHODS: A total of 201 female patients in the 18-50 age group with no history of chronic and cardiac disease or anaemia were included in the study. Patients were divided into 3 groups based on their ferritin levels. Twelve lead EKGs were obtained from each patient, and fQRS, Tp-e interval, Tp-e/QT and Tp-e/QTc ratios were calculated manually. RESULTS: A total of 201 female patients with an average age of 37 ± 9 were included in the study. Group 1 (ferritin<15 ng/mL) consisted of 79 (39.3%) patients, Group 2 (ferritin 15-30 ng/mL) consisted of 64 patients (31.8%) and Group 3 (ferritin≥30 ng/mL) consisted of 58 (28.9%) patients. Tp-e interval was significantly higher in Group 1 compared to Group 2 and 3 (p < 0.001). A similar relationship was also observed between Tp-e/QT, Tp-e/QTc and fQRS (p < 0.001). A moderate, negative relationship was found in the correlation analysis of Tp-e, Tp-e/QT, Tp-e/QTc and fQRS with ferritin value [r = -0.519 (p = 0.001), r = -0.485 (p = 0.001), r = -0.540 (p = 0.001) and r = -0.345 (p = 0.001), respectively]. CONCLUSION: As a result of the study, it was found that low iron storage may increase arrhythmogenic susceptibility through increased fragmented QRS presence, increased Tp-e interval, Tp-e/QT and Tp-e/QTc ratios in healthy women of childbearing age.

BACKGROUND: It has been reported in the literature that the increase in body temperature shortens QT interval on electrocardiogram through heart rate modulation. However, the effects of fever on ventricular repolarization are not clearly known. This study elaborates on QT interval of isolated fever, corrected QT (cQT), Tp-e interval, the ratio of corrected Tp-e (cTp-e) and Tp-e/QT, and their impacts on arrhythmia potential. METHODS: This prospective study was performed on 74 patients without any active and chronic diseases other than fever and upper respiratory tract infection. The study included patients at the age of 18-50 years suffering from fever above 38.2 °C. QT and Tp-e intervals of the patients were measured from their ECGs taken in febrile and afebrile periods. cQT and cTp-e values were calculated according to Bazett, Fridericia, and Framingham formulations. RESULTS: QT and Tp-e intervals were observed to be shorter in the febrile period (p < 0.001 and p = 0.006 respectively). cTp-e was found to be longer in the febrile period according to Bazett, Fridericia, and Framingham formulations (p < 0.001, p = 0.002, p < 0.001, respectively). Tp-e/QT ratio was found to be higher in the febrile period than in the afebrile period (p < 0.001). CONCLUSION: Although QT, cQT, and Tpe intervals were shorter, cTpe interval and Tpe/QT ratio were longer and higher in the febrile period, respectively. These findings may indicate that fever may create a proarrhythmic effect by causing variability in the transmural distribution of myocardial repolarization.

BACKGROUND: There is limited data on cardiac arrhythmias and ventricular repolarization and dispersion abnormalities in patients with mitochondrial diseases (MitD). METHODS: Consecutive 40 patients with genetically proven MitD and 35 healthy controls were studied. Among other examinations all subjects underwent 24-h Holter recording and 12­lead electrocardiography (ECG) with corrected QT (QTc), QT dispersion (QTd), Tp-e and Tp-e/QT ratio assessment. RESULTS: Patients with MitD were 55.4 ± 15.7 years old, the disease duration was 18.5 ± 10.3 years, presented 6 clinical syndromes while mitochondrial and nuclear DNA type of mutation was present in 40 and 60% of cases, respectively. In MitD more frequently 1st degree atrioventricular block and intraventricular conduction defects were observed and also QRS complex duration was increased. Mean values of QTc (p = 0.001), QTd (p = 0.02), Tp-e (p < 0.00001) and Tp-e/QT (p < 0.00001) were significantly higher in MitD than in controls. Correlations between disease duration and PR interval duration (p = 0.003) and Creatine Kinase MB isoenzyme activity (p = 0.02) were found. No differences in depolarization and dispersion parameters were observed according to type of mutation or dominant clinical syndromes. In addition to supraventricular extrasystoles, nonsustained supraventricular tachycardias occurred more frequently in MitD (in 45.0 vs 14.3%, p = 0.0004). Ventricular arrhythmias were rare and observed almost exclusively in subjects with mitochondrial DNA mutation. CONCLUSIONS: In contrast to healthy controls, in MitD patients intraventricular, repolarization and dispersion disturbances were more frequently observed. In addition to bradyarrhythmias observed in some defined MitD syndromes, supraventricular rather than ventricular arrhythmias are more common.

INTRODUCTION: Aortic stenosis (AS) is the most common degenerative valvular heart disease that can affect left ventricular functions. Tp-e interval and Tp-e/QT ratio is a novel repolarization marker which is associated with adverse cardiovascular events in several cardiovascular diseases. In our study, our aim is to investigate the prognostic effect of Tp-e interval, Tp-e/QT and Tp-e/QTc ratios on mortality in patients who underwent successful surgical aortic valve replacement (AVR). METHODS: A total of three hundred seventy-five patients undergoing successful surgical AVR were included in this study. Then, patients were divided into two groups according to mortality as group 1 without mortality (342 patients) and group 2 with mortality (33 patients). Tp-e interval, Tp-e/QT, and Tp-e/QTc ratios were calculated for both groups. RESULTS: Tp-e interval (71 (63.7-77); 86 (84-88), p < .001), Tp-e/QT ratio (0.19 (0.17-0.20); 0.23 (0.22-0.23), p < .001) and Tp-e/QTc ratio (0.17 ± 0.02; 0.21 ± 0.01, p < .001) were higher in group 2 compared to group 1. In multivariate logistic regression analyses Tp-e interval (odds ratio [OR]: 1.315, 95% confidence interval [CI]: 1.203-1.437, p < .001), Tp-e/QT ratio (OR: 7.334, 95% CI: 3.274-1.643, p < .001) and Tp-e/QTc ratio (OR: 2.567, 95% CI: 4.106-1.605, p < .001) were found to be independent predictors of mortality. Additionally, a Kaplan-Meier survival analysis also revealed that long term survival was found to be significantly decreased in patients with higher Tp-e/QT ratio (Log-Rank p < .001) and Tp-e/QTc ratio (Log-Rank p < .001). CONCLUSION: Tp-e interval, Tp-e dispersion, Tp-e/QT, and Tp-e/QTc ratios are associated with worse prognosis after surgical AVR in patients with severe AS. All of them are also independent predictors of mortality.

BACKGROUND: There are no data on the influence of disease severity and cardiac autonomic tone on ventricular repolarization and dispersion in 24-hour Holter monitoring in systemic lupus erythematosus (SLE). METHODS: Consecutive 92 SLE and 51 healthy subjects were studied. The standard 12-lead electrocardiography (ECG), Holter monitoring with heart rate turbulence (HRT) and QT, Tp-e and Tp-e/QT ratio assessment (including corrected values) were performed. Subjects with conditions causing repolarization abnormalities or insufficient number of beats suitable for QT evaluation were excluded (17 SLE and 8 controls). RESULTS: Finally, 75 SLE and 43 sex- and age-matched controls were included to the study. In SLE patients, the median disease severity score (Systemic Lupus International Collaborating Clinics/American College of Rheumatology Damage Index (SLICC/ACR-DI)) was 3.0. The mean values of QTc, cTp-e and cTp-e/QTc were significantly higher in SLE patients than in controls. QTc ≥ 460 ms was observed in 18.7% of patients using standard ECG and in 58.7% using Holter monitoring. With Holter monitoring, patients with SLICC/ACR-DI >3.0 presented longer QTc than those with SLICC/ACR-DI ≤3.0 (418±15 vs. 409 ± 16, p = 0.04), while cTp-e and cTp-e/QTc values were similar. Patients with abnormal HRT presented longer cTp-e and higher cTp-e/QTc than those with normal HRT (92 ± 52 vs. 71 ± 16 ms, p = 0.04; 0.244 ± 0.126 vs. 0.187 ± 0.035, p = 0.03), while QTc values were similar. No differences in QT and Tp-e parameters were observed according to disease duration. CONCLUSION: In SLE patients, Holter monitoring revealed QTc prolongation more frequently than standard ECG. Longer QTc values were observed in patients with more advanced disease, while increased cTp-e and cTp-e/QTc were related to cardiac autonomic dysfunction expressed by abnormal HRT.

BACKGROUND: Percutaneous coronary intervention (PCI) is effective in treating patients with acute coronary syndrome (ACS) but is associated with some serious complications. Nicorandil is an anti-anginal agent acting to improve microvascular circulation and to increase coronary blood flow. The objective of this article is to evaluate the effects of intracoronary injection followed with continuous intravenous injection of nicorandil on ECG parameters in patients with unstable angina pectoris (UA) undergoing PCI. METHODS: A single-center, self-controlled clinical trial was conducted at the Second Hospital of Tianjin Medical University between January 2019 and April 2019. Sixty-three consecutive patients with UA who received coronary angiography and selective PCI were enrolled. ECG was recorded and analyzed before and 24 hr after nicorandil infusion. RESULTS: Patients were divided into three groups: control group (n = 23, aged 63.43 ± 12.55 years), short-term, and prolonged use with nicorandil group (n = 20 and 20, aged 66.45 ± 8.06 years and 65.80 ± 9.49 years, respectively). Clinical characteristics and ECG parameters were similar before PCI among three groups (p > .05). In nicorandil treatment groups, intervals of QTd and Tp-e in patients post-PCI were significantly shorter than that in control and pre-PCI (p < .05). CONCLUSIONS: Nicorandil infusion reduces QTd and Tp-e interval in patients with UA. Further studies will be needed to determine whether these electrophysiological changes are associated with a reduction of ventricular arrhythmias and improved outcomes.

INTRODUCTION: The risk of sudden cardiac death (SCD) and arrhythmias has been shown to be common in chronic obstructive pulmonary disease (COPD) subjects. We aimed to evaluate the markers of arrhythmia such as QT, QTc (corrected QT), Tp-e, and cTp-e (corrected Tp-e) intervals, Tp-e/QT ratio, and Tp-e/QTc ratio in newly diagnosed COPD subjects in both right and left precordial leads. MATERIALS AND METHODS: The study group consisted of 74 subjects with obstructive respiratory function tests (RFTs). The control group consisted of 78 subjects who had nonobstructive RFTs. RFTs, electrocardiograms (ECG), and transthoracic echocardiograms (TTE) were performed, and QTR (QT interval in right precordial leads), QTL (QT interval in left precordial leads), Tp-eR (Tp-e interval in right precordial leads), and Tp-eL (Tp-e interval in left precordial leads) intervals; systolic pulmonary arterial pressure (sPAP); forced expiratory volume in one second (FEV1 )/forced vital capacity (FVC); and peripheral oxygen saturation(POS) values were measured. RESULTS: Tp-eR interval 85.82 ± 5.34 millisecond (ms) versus 62.87 ± 3.55 ms (t = 31.29/p < .00001), cTp-eR interval 97.51 ± 7.18 ms versus 71.07 ± 4.58 ms (t = 27.20/p < .00001), Tp-eR/QTR ratio 0.234 ± 0.02 versus 0.164 ± 0.01 (t = 2.2/p = .014), and Tp-eR/QTcR ratio 0.201 ± 0.01 versus 0.141 ± 0.01 (t = 1.92/p = .028) were statistically significantly higher in COPD subjects. There was a strong negative correlation between RFT and sPAP (sPAP, 29.93 ± 5.1 mm Hg; and FEV1 /FVC, 63.78 ± 3.33%, r = -.85/p < .00001). There was a moderate positive correlation between sPAP and Tp-eR. CONCLUSION: We found Tp-e and cTp-e intervals, Tp-e/QT ratio, and Tp-e/QTc ratio were significantly higher in the COPD patients than in the control group. In addition, in the COPD group, heart rate variability (HRV) parameters were significantly lower on ECG.

Introduction: There is no study evaluating the Tp-e/QT and Tp-e/QTc ratios with T wave peak to end interval (Tp-e interval) used for evaluation of cardiac arrhythmia risk and ventricular repolarization changes in patients with primary aldosteronism (PA). We aimed to investigate whether there was a change in Tp-e interval, Tp-e/QT and Tp-e/QTc ratios in patients with PA.Method: Thirty patients with newly diagnosed hypertension (HT) and PA and 30 patients with primary HT were included. Twelve-lead electrocardiography (ECG) was performed in all patients. Tp-e interval, Tp-e/QT and Tp-e/QTc ratios were measured in addition to routine measurements in ECG.Results: Sodium, potassium, and plasma renin activity (PRA) were significantly lower in patients with PA; systolic and diastolic blood pressure, plasma aldosterone, plasma aldosterone/PRA were significantly higher in patients with PA (p < .05 for each one). When ventricular repolarization parameters were examined; while QT and QTc interval were similar between two groups, Tp-e interval, Tp-e/QT and Tp-e/QTc ratio values were significantly higher in patients with PA (p < .05 for each one). Tp-e interval, Tp-e/QT and Tp-e/QTc ratio values were positively correlated with the serum calcium, aldosterone, and aldosterone/PRA levels and negatively correlated with serum sodium, potassium, renin levels (p < .05 for each one). In linear regression analyses, Tp-e interval, Tp-e/QT and Tp-e/QTc ratios were independently associated with the aldosterone/PRA ratio.Conclusion: Tp-e interval, Tp-e/QT and Tp-e/QTc were increased in hypertensive patients with PA and were independently associated with aldosterone/PRA levels. This may be related to the changing neuroendocrine state in patients with PA.

INTRODUCTION: Benign paroxysmal positional vertigo (BPPV) is a common diagnosis for dizziness patients admitting to emergency department and for initial diagnosis, cardiac causes of dizziness should be excluded at admittance. Electrocardiography (ECG) is a simple method to detect cardiac arrhythmias for these patients. Tp-e interval and Tp-e/QTc ratio are transmural repolarization parameters and shown to be strongly related to ventricular arrhythmias. With this study, we aim to investigate ventricular repolarization parameters like Tp-e interval and Tp-e/QTc ratio which can be easily evaluated by ECG in BPPV patients. MATERIALS AND METHODS: A total of 84 newly diagnosed BPPV patients and 59 age-sex matched control group without dizziness symptoms compatible with inclusion criteria were included for the study. Patients with previous vertigo, coronary artery disease, renal disease, heart failure, severe valvular disease, arrhythmia history, electrolyte disturbances and patients under 18 years of age were excluded. RESULTS: Mean age of the study population was 44.4 ±â€¯12.1 years, 36.4% were male. There was no significant difference among groups in terms of age, sex, diabetes mellitus, hypertension and hypothyroidism history. When ECG results were evaluated QRS interval, QT interval, Tp-e interval, Tp-e/QT ratio and Tp-e/QTc ratio were statistically higher in BPPV patients compared to control group (p = 0.000, p = 0.047, p = 0.000, p = 0.000 and p = 0.001, respectively). DISCUSSION: As a result of our study, Tp-e and Tp-e/QTc ratio were significantly higher in BPPV patients compared to the control group. These findings suggest that ventricular arrhythmia risk may be higher in BPPV patients. Further evaluation of these patients in terms of ventricular arrhythmia would be beneficial.

INTRODUCTION: Coronavirus disease 2019 (COVID-19) is a newly recognized infectious disease that has spread rapidly. COVID-19 has been associated with a number of cardiovascular complications, including arrhythmias. The mechanism of ventricular arrhythmias in patients with COVID-19 is uncertain. The aim of the present study was to evaluate the ventricular repolarization by using the Tp-e interval, QT dispersion, Tp-e/QT ratio, and Tp-e/QTc ratio as candidate markers of ventricular arrhythmias in patients with newly diagnosed COVID-19. In addition, the relationship between the repolarization parameters and the CRP (C-reactive protein) was investigated. METHODS: 75 newly diagnosed COVID-19 patients, 75 age and sex matched healthy subjects were included in the study between 20th March 2020 and 10th April 2020. The risk of ventricular arrhythmias was evaluated by calculating the electrocardiographic Tp-e and QT interval, Tp-e dispersion, corrected QT(QTc), QT dispersion (QTd), corrected QTd, Tp-e/QT and Tp-e/QTc ratios. CRP values were also measured in patients with newly diagnosed COVID-19. RESULTS: Tp-e interval (80.7 ±â€¯4.6 vs. 70.9 ±â€¯4.8; p < .001), Tp-e / QT ratio (0.21 ±â€¯0.01 vs. 0.19 ±â€¯0.01; p < .001) and Tp-e/QTc ratio (0.19 ±â€¯0.01 vs.0.17 ±â€¯0.01; p < .001) were significantly higher in patients with newly diagnosed COVID-19 than the control group. There was a significant positive correlation between Tp-e interval, Tp-e/QTc ratio and CRP in patients with newly diagnosed COVID-19 (rs = 0.332, p = .005, rs = 0.397, p < .001 consecutively). During their treatment with hydroxychloroquine (HCQ), azithromycin and favipiravir, ventricular tachycardia episodes were observed in in two COVID-19 patients during their hospitalization in the intensive care unit. CONCLUSION: Our study showed for the first time in literature that the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io, which are evaluated electrocardiographically in patients with newly diagnosed COVID-19, were prolonged compared with normal healthy individuals. A positive correlation was determined between repolarization parameters and CRP. We believe that pre-treatment evaluation of repolarization parameters in newly diagnosed COVID-19 would be beneficial for predicting ventricular arrhythmia risk.

INTRODUCTION: Major burn injury is an acute stress reaction with systemic effects. Major burn injury has been associated with a number of cardiovascular dysfunctions, including ventricular arrhythmias. The mechanism of increased ventricular arrhythmias in burn patients uncertain. The aim of the present study was to evaluate the ventricular repolarization by using the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io as candidate markers of ventricular arrhythmias in patients with major burn patients. In addition, the relationship between the repolarization parameters and the CRP(C-reactive protein) and ABSI(Abbreviated Burn Severity Index) score was investigated. METHODS: 55 major burn patients, 55 age and sex matched healthy subjects were included in the study between January 2017 and September 2019. The risk of ventricular arrhythmias was evaluated by calculating the electrocardiographic Tp-e and QT interval, corrected QT(QTc), Tp-e/QT and Tp-e/QTc ratios. ABSI score was calculated in burn patients. Left ventricular functions were evaluated by echocardiography. RESULTS: Tp-e interval (80.7 ±â€¯5.7 vs. 67.4 ±â€¯5.7; p < 0.001), Tp-e/QT ratio (0.21 ±â€¯0.01 vs. 0.18 ±â€¯0.01; p < 0.001) and Tp-e/QTc ratio (0.20 ±â€¯0.01 vs.0.17 ±â€¯0.01; p < 0.001) were significantly higher in major burn patients than the control group. There was a significant positive correlation between Tp-e interval, Tp-e/QTc ratio and ABSI score in major burn patients (r = 0.870, p < 0.001, r = 0.312, p = 0.020 consecutively). CONCLUSION: Our study showed for the first time in literature that the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io, which were evaluated electrocardiographically in major burn patients, were prolonged compared with normal healthy individuals. A positive correlation was determined between repolarization parameters and ABSI score. Whether these changes increase the risk of ventricular arrhythmia deserve further studies. TAKE-HOME MESSAGE: Tp-e interval, Tp-e/QT ratio, and Tp-e/QTc ratio, which were evaluated electrocardiographically in major burn patients, were prolonged compared with normal healthy individuals and a positive correlation was found between these repolarization parameters and burn severity.
